Concentration in fewer stocks
TRADING is getting increasingly concentrated in a small number of stocks. The top 100 stocks accounted for around 96 per cent of the turnover in 2001-02. And within this universe, the focus narrows further on a smaller number of stocks. Sample ... More

What is hedging?
Recent newspaper reports suggest that SEBI may encourage mutual funds to hedge their market risk. What is hedging? It refers to a portfolio management technique that helps reduce risk. Suppose a mutual fund has invested in stocks, and the fund ... More
